What is an example of an autotroph and a heterotroph?

Biology
1 answer:
drek231 [11]4 years ago
8 0
Autotroph: Any kind of plant because they can create their own food.
Heterotroph: Humans because we can't create our own food.

5. What is another word for Lithogenous
AlexFokin [52]

The answer is Marine Sediments or Sediments. Lithogenous is a sediments derived from preexisting rocks on land, it is also a type of marine sediment that forms thickest deposits worldwide, and it is sediment that begins as rocks on continents or island. An example of lithogenous sediment is sandstone.
